Quilt Vs Tapestry. A tapestry is made by repeatedly weaving the horizontal (weft) threads over and under the vertical (warp) threads, then squishing (or tamping) those. Quilts are typically made up of numerous patches of different cloth stictched together to form a single blanket. Their intricate designs and historical significance make them prominent focal points. Old quilts became museum pieces and inspired new works. Wool is the material that has been most widely used for tapestry weaving, traditionally used for both the warp and weft threads. As well as being readily available and easy to dye, its natural strength and flexibility lend themselves well to tapestry weaving.
